text: Koyashskoye or Koiaske is a salt lake on the coast of the Kerch Peninsula in Crimea, separated from the Black Sea by a strip of land. It is 4 kilometers long, 2 kilometers wide and a meter deep. The lake has the particularity to have a pink to scarlet color, depending on the light, due to the presence of microscopic algae living in the water.
